THIRTY-three people, including 27 schoolgirls, have been taken to hospital after a school bus collided with a truck north-west of Melbourne.
The crash took place on the Western Highway at Bacchus Marsh about 3.15am (local time).
The bus, with students on board, rolled down an embankment.
One girl suffered serious injuries, as did the male truck driver.
The other 26 students on the bus, along with four adults and the bus driver, have been taken to hospital for observation.
The students were on their way to Melbourne Airport where they were set to travel to a space camp in the US.

The Melbourne-bound lanes of the Western Highway are expected to remain closed for several hours and motorists are urged to take an alternative route.
